Synspective and KSAT Deepen Strategic Alliance to Strengthen Global SAR Satellite Operations
Synspective and KSAT are expanding their strategic alliance to strengthen SAR satellite operations, improve global data delivery, and support the growth of Synspective’s Earth observation constellation. The partnership focuses on low-latency satellite communications, operational resilience, maritime domain awareness, and next-generation geospatial intelligence capabilities.

Venturi Space Commits €250 Million to France as Toulouse Emerges as a European Hub for Lunar Mobility
Venturi Space has announced a €250 million investment to establish a major lunar and Martian mobility technology center in Toulouse, France. The new facility will create nearly 200 high-skilled jobs by 2030 and support advanced rover technologies for future NASA Artemis missions and European lunar exploration programs.

PLD Space Expands Investment in Guiana Space Centre to €35 Million, Strengthening Europe’s Sovereign Launch Capabilities
European launch provider PLD Space has announced a major expansion of its investment in launch infrastructure at the Guiana Space Centre (CSG), committing €35 million between 2025 and 2026 to accelerate development of its MIURA 5 launch complex.

Frontex Deploys Authenticated Satellite Tracking in Black Sea Patrol Operations
Frontex and the Romanian Border Police have successfully piloted a Galileo-enabled satellite tracking system designed to counter spoofing and jamming threats in the Black Sea. The initiative marks a major step in integrating authenticated EU space-based navigation capabilities into frontline maritime security and border protection operations.

Rocket Lab Expands Deep Space Ambitions with Acquisition of Robotics Pioneer Motiv Space Systems
Rocket Lab is set to acquire robotics specialist Motiv Space Systems, strengthening its capabilities in deep space robotics, spacecraft mechanisms, and satellite manufacturing. The deal brings Mars-proven robotic technologies and critical spacecraft components in-house, accelerating Rocket Lab’s ambitions in planetary exploration, national security, and constellation-scale satellite production.

True Anomaly Raises $650M to Accelerate Space Superiority Capabilities
True Anomaly has raised $650M in Series D funding, surpassing $1B total capital, to accelerate space superiority capabilities. As space becomes a contested warfighting domain, the company is scaling autonomous spacecraft, mission software, and interceptor systems to deliver operational advantage for the U.S. and its allies.

Airbus, Thales Alenia Space, and RADMOR Secure Landmark Polish Military Satellite Deal
Airbus, Thales Alenia Space, and RADMOR are joining forces to develop a sovereign geostationary defense satellite for Poland. Backed by Europe’s Readiness 2030 strategy, the program will deliver secure, anti-jamming communications, strengthening Poland’s military autonomy in an increasingly contested space domain.

DARPA Selects Benchmark Space Systems for Lunar Water Mapping Mission Study
Benchmark Space Systems has been selected by DARPA to study next-generation spacecraft technologies for mapping lunar water resources from very low lunar orbit. The LASSO program aims to unlock high-resolution sensing capabilities while advancing hybrid propulsion, autonomous navigation, and mission architectures critical for future cislunar operations.

e-GEOS Expands Global Reach of SAOCOM Data in Strategic Partnership with VENG
e-GEOS and VENG have signed a multi-year agreement to expand global access to SAOCOM satellite data. The partnership strengthens international Earth observation capabilities, leveraging L-band SAR technology for applications ranging from disaster management to infrastructure monitoring and environmental protection.

IonQ Acquires Skyloom to Build Space-Based Quantum Network Infrastructure
IonQ is expanding its quantum leadership with the acquisition of Skyloom Global, bringing advanced space-based optical communications into its growing full-stack quantum ecosystem. Backed by $3.5B in funding, IonQ aims to build a global quantum key distribution platform linking ground and satellite networks for secure, planet-scale connectivity.

Virgin Media O2 Partners with Starlink to Bring Satellite-to-Mobile Coverage Nationwide Across the UK
Virgin Media O2 has announced a multi-year partnership with Starlink Direct to Cell to launch O2 Satellite, the UK’s first satellite-powered mobile service. Using Starlink’s LEO constellation, the service will deliver messaging and data coverage in remote areas, boosting Virgin Media O2’s UK landmass coverage to over 95% within 12 months of launch.
